Whole blood transcriptional profiles and the pathogenesis of tuberculous meningitis
Mortality and morbidity from tuberculous meningitis (TBM) are common, primarily due to inflammatory response to Mycobacterium tuberculosis infection, yet the underlying mechanisms remain poorly understood.
